## Connection example

<!-- TODO[g-despot] Refactor into an import and reuse in Cloud docs to avoid duplication -->

To connect, use the `REST Endpoint` and the `Admin` API key stored as [environment variables](#environment-variables):

:::::tabs{sync="languages"}
:::tab{title="Python"}
```python
import weaviate
from weaviate.classes.init import Auth

# Best practice: store your credentials in environment variables
weaviate_url = os.environ["WEAVIATE_URL"]
weaviate_api_key = os.environ["WEAVIATE_API_KEY"]

# Connect to Weaviate Cloud
client = weaviate.connect_to_weaviate_cloud(
    cluster_url=weaviate_url,
    auth_credentials=Auth.api_key(weaviate_api_key),
)

print(client.is_ready())  # Should print: `True`

client.close()  # Free up resources
```
:::

:::tab{title="JavaScript/TypeScript"}
```typescript
// Set these environment variables
// WEAVIATE_URL      your WCD instance URL
// WEAVIATE_API_KEY  your WCD instance API key

const weaviateURL = process.env.WEAVIATE_URL as string
const weaviateKey = process.env.WEAVIATE_API_KEY as string

const client: WeaviateClient = await weaviate.connectToWeaviateCloud(weaviateURL, {
    authCredentials: new weaviate.ApiKey(weaviateKey),
  }
)
```
:::

::::tab{title="Go"}
```goraw
// Set these environment variables
// WEAVIATE_HOSTNAME    Your Weaviate instance hostname
// WEAVIATE_API_KEY    Your Weaviate instance API key

package main

import (
  "context"
  "fmt"
  "os"

  "github.com/weaviate/weaviate-go-client/v5/weaviate"
  "github.com/weaviate/weaviate-go-client/v5/weaviate/auth"
)

// Create the client
func CreateClient() {
  cfg := weaviate.Config{
    Host:       os.Getenv("WEAVIATE_HOSTNAME"),
    Scheme:     "https",
    AuthConfig: auth.ApiKey{Value: os.Getenv("WEAVIATE_API_KEY")},
    Headers:    nil,
  }

  client, err := weaviate.NewClient(cfg)
  if err != nil {
    fmt.Println(err)
  }

  // Check the connection
  live, err := client.Misc().LiveChecker().Do(context.Background())
  if err != nil {
    panic(err)
  }
  fmt.Printf("%v", live)

}

func main() {
  CreateClient()
}
```

:::callout{intent="warning"}
This client uses the `hostname` parameter (without the `https` scheme) instead of a complete `URL`.
:::
::::

:::tab{title="Java"}
```java
// Best practice: store your credentials in environment variables
String weaviateUrl = System.getenv("WEAVIATE_URL");
String weaviateApiKey = System.getenv("WEAVIATE_API_KEY");

WeaviateClient client = WeaviateClient.connectToWeaviateCloud(weaviateUrl, // Replace with your Weaviate Cloud URL
    weaviateApiKey // Replace with your Weaviate Cloud key
);

System.out.println(client.isReady()); // Should print: `True`

client.close(); // Free up resources
```
:::

:::tab{title="C#"}
```csharp
// Best practice: store your credentials in environment variables
string weaviateUrl = Environment.GetEnvironmentVariable("WEAVIATE_URL");
string weaviateApiKey = Environment.GetEnvironmentVariable("WEAVIATE_API_KEY");

WeaviateClient client = await Connect.Cloud(
    weaviateUrl, // Replace with your Weaviate Cloud URL
    weaviateApiKey // Replace with your Weaviate Cloud key
);

var isReady = await client.IsReady();
Console.WriteLine(isReady);
```
:::

:::tab{title="cURL"}
```bash
# Set these environment variables
# WEAVIATE_URL      your Weaviate instance URL
# WEAVIATE_API_KEY  your Weaviate instance API key

curl https://${WEAVIATE_URL}/v1/meta -H "Authorization: Bearer ${WEAVIATE_API_KEY}" | jq
```
:::
:::::

## Third party API keys

If you use API-based models for vectorization or RAG, you must provide an API key for the service. To add third party API keys, follow these examples:

:::code-group{sync="languages"}
```python title="Python"
import os
import weaviate
from weaviate.classes.init import Auth

# Best practice: store your credentials in environment variables
weaviate_url = os.environ["WEAVIATE_URL"]
weaviate_api_key = os.environ["WEAVIATE_API_KEY"]
cohere_api_key = os.environ["COHERE_API_KEY"]

# Connect to Weaviate Cloud
client = weaviate.connect_to_weaviate_cloud(
    cluster_url=weaviate_url,
    auth_credentials=Auth.api_key(weaviate_api_key),
    headers={
        "X-Cohere-Api-Key": cohere_api_key
    }
)

print(client.is_ready())
```

```typescript title="JavaScript/TypeScript"
// Set these environment variables
// WEAVIATE_URL      your Weaviate instance URL
// WEAVIATE_API_KEY  your Weaviate instance API key
// COHERE_API_KEY    your Cohere API key

const weaviateURL = process.env.WEAVIATE_URL as string
const weaviateKey = process.env.WEAVIATE_API_KEY as string
const cohereKey = process.env.COHERE_API_KEY as string

const client: WeaviateClient = await weaviate.connectToWeaviateCloud(weaviateURL, {
  authCredentials: new weaviate.ApiKey(weaviateKey),
    headers: {
     'X-Cohere-Api-Key': cohereKey,
   }
  }
)
```

```goraw title="Go"
// Set these environment variables
// WEAVIATE_URL      your Weaviate instance URL
// WEAVIATE_API_KEY  your Weaviate instance API key
// COHERE_API_KEY    your Cohere API key

package main

import (
  "context"
  "fmt"
  "os"
  "github.com/weaviate/weaviate-go-client/v5/weaviate"
  "github.com/weaviate/weaviate-go-client/v5/weaviate/auth"
)

// Create the client
func CreateClient() {
cfg := weaviate.Config{
    Host: os.Getenv("WEAVIATE_HOSTNAME"),   // URL only, no scheme prefix
    Scheme: "https",
    AuthConfig: auth.ApiKey{Value: os.Getenv("WEAVIATE_API_KEY")},
    Headers: map[string]string{
        "X-Cohere-Api-Key": os.Getenv("WEAVIATE_COHERE_KEY"),
    },
}

client, err := weaviate.NewClient(cfg)
if err != nil{
    fmt.Println(err)
}

// Check the connection
live, err := client.Misc().LiveChecker().Do(context.Background())
if err != nil {
  panic(err)
}
fmt.Printf("%v", live)
}

func main() {
  CreateClient()
}
```

```java title="Java"
// Best practice: store your credentials in environment variables
String weaviateUrl = System.getenv("WEAVIATE_URL");
String weaviateApiKey = System.getenv("WEAVIATE_API_KEY");
String cohereApiKey = System.getenv("COHERE_API_KEY");

WeaviateClient client = WeaviateClient.connectToWeaviateCloud(weaviateUrl, // Replace with your Weaviate Cloud URL
    weaviateApiKey, // Replace with your Weaviate Cloud key
    config -> config.setHeaders(Map.of("X-Cohere-Api-Key", cohereApiKey)));

System.out.println(client.isReady()); // Should print: `True`

client.close(); // Free up resources
```

```csharp title="C#"
// Best practice: store your credentials in environment variables
string weaviateUrl = Environment.GetEnvironmentVariable("WEAVIATE_URL");
string weaviateApiKey = Environment.GetEnvironmentVariable("WEAVIATE_API_KEY");
string cohereApiKey = Environment.GetEnvironmentVariable("COHERE_API_KEY");

WeaviateClient client = await Connect.Cloud(
    weaviateUrl, // Replace with your Weaviate Cloud URL
    weaviateApiKey, // Replace with your Weaviate Cloud key
    new Dictionary<string, string> { { "X-Cohere-Api-Key", cohereApiKey } }
);

var isReady = await client.IsReady();
Console.WriteLine(isReady);
```

```bash title="cURL"
# Set these environment variables
# WEAVIATE_URL      your Weaviate instance URL
# WEAVIATE_API_KEY  your Weaviate instance API key
# COHERE_API_KEY    your Cohere API key

curl https://${WEAVIATE_URL}/v1/meta \
-H 'Content-Type: application/json' \
-H "X-Cohere-Api-Key: ${COHERE_API_KEY}" \
-H "Authorization: Bearer ${WEAVIATE_API_KEY}" | jq
```
:::

## Environment variables

:::callout{intent="warning"}
Do not hard-code API keys or other credentials in your client code. Use environment variables or a similar secure coding technique instead.
:::

Environment variables keep sensitive details out of your source code. Your application imports the information to runtime.

::::accordion{title="Set an environment variable."}
In these examples, the environment variable names are in UPPER\_CASE.

:::code-group{sync="languages"}
```bash title="Bash/Zsh"
export WEAVIATE_URL="http://localhost:8080"
export WEAVIATE_API_KEY="sAmPleKEY8FwELJILn0YDRG9gjy4hReqfInz"
```

```shell title="Windows PowerShell"
$Env:WEAVIATE_URL="http://localhost:8080"
$Env:WEAVIATE_API_KEY="sAmPleKEY8FwELJILn0YDRG9gjy4hReqfInz"
```

```shell title="Windows Command Prompt"
set WEAVIATE_URL=http://localhost:8080
set WEAVIATE_API_KEY=sAmPleKEY8FwELJILn0YDRG9gjy4hReqfInz
```
:::
::::

::::accordion{title="Import an environment variable."}
:::code-group{sync="languages"}
```python title="Python"
weaviate_url = os.getenv("WEAVIATE_URL")
weaviate_key = os.getenv("WEAVIATE_API_KEY")
```

```js title="JavaScript/TypeScript"
const weaviateUrl = process.env.WEAVIATE_URL;
const weaviateKey = process.env.WEAVIATE_API_KEY;
```

```go title="Go"
weaviateUrl := os.Getenv("WEAVIATE_URL")
weaviateKey := os.Getenv("WEAVIATE_API_KEY")
```
:::
::::

## gRPC timeouts

The Python client v4 and TypeScript client v3 use [gRPC](../apis/grpc.md). The gRPC protocol is sensitive to network delay. If you encounter connection timeouts, adjust the timeout values for initialization, queries, and insertions.

:::code-group{sync="languages"}
```python title="Python"
import weaviate, os
from weaviate.classes.init import Auth
from weaviate.classes.init import AdditionalConfig, Timeout

# Best practice: store your credentials in environment variables
weaviate_url = os.environ["WEAVIATE_URL"]
weaviate_api_key = os.environ["WEAVIATE_API_KEY"]

# Connect to a WCD instance
client = weaviate.connect_to_weaviate_cloud(
    cluster_url=weaviate_url,
    auth_credentials=Auth.api_key(weaviate_api_key),
    # skip_init_checks=True,
    additional_config=AdditionalConfig(
        timeout=Timeout(init=30, query=60, insert=120)  # Values in seconds
    )
)

print(client.is_ready())
```

```typescript title="JavaScript/TypeScript"
// Set these environment variables
// WEAVIATE_URL       your Weaviate instance URL
// WEAVIATE_API_KEY   your Weaviate instance API key

const weaviateURL = process.env.WEAVIATE_URL as string
const weaviateKey = process.env.WEAVIATE_API_KEY as string

const client: WeaviateClient = await weaviate.connectToWeaviateCloud(weaviateURL, {
  authCredentials: new weaviate.ApiKey(weaviateKey),
    timeout: { init: 30, query: 60, insert: 120 } // Values in seconds
  }
)

console.log(client)
```

```java title="Java"
// Best practice: store your credentials in environment variables
String weaviateUrl = System.getenv("WEAVIATE_URL");
String weaviateApiKey = System.getenv("WEAVIATE_API_KEY");

WeaviateClient client = WeaviateClient.connectToWeaviateCloud(weaviateUrl, // Replace with your Weaviate Cloud URL
    weaviateApiKey, // Replace with your Weaviate Cloud key
    config -> config.timeout(30, 60, 120)); // Values in seconds

System.out.println(client.isReady()); // Should print: `True`

client.close(); // Free up resources
```

```csharp title="C#"
// Best practice: store your credentials in environment variables
string weaviateUrl = Environment.GetEnvironmentVariable("WEAVIATE_URL");
string weaviateApiKey = Environment.GetEnvironmentVariable("WEAVIATE_API_KEY");

WeaviateClient client = await Connect.Cloud(
    weaviateUrl,
    weaviateApiKey,
    initTimeout: TimeSpan.FromSeconds(30),
    queryTimeout: TimeSpan.FromSeconds(60),
    insertTimeout: TimeSpan.FromSeconds(120)
);

var isReady = await client.IsReady();
Console.WriteLine(isReady);
```
:::
